
Discreet Visit of Freedom and Justice Party Delegation to Istanbul is a sign of Turkey and Egypt uniting. Deputies from Egypt’s Freedom and Justice Party made high profile visits to famous author Adnan Oktar and the popular Governor of Istanbul, as well as the Deputy Mayor. The delegation also met with prominent Turkish political figures at a meeting at the Hilton Hotel.
The delegation from Egypt, including familiar faces from the Freedom and Justice Party such as Dr. Abdulmawgoud Dardery, (known for his regular appearances on CNN and Al -Jazeera with his insight on the latest events in Egypt) and founding member Mohamed Abdelsalam Elsanousy as well as fresh faces like Saad Ahmed, also a founding member of the FJP and responsible for education and civil society in the Luxor region, made high profile visits.
The delegation’s first stop, after the warm welcome by Adnan Oktar’s team, was at the Hilton’s conference room, where famous Turkish political figures gave their insights on the Turkish experience of democracy and reform. In exchange, their Egyptian guests shared the latest news on Egypt and their efforts to speed up the process of reforming and rebuilding Egypt. At the end of the meeting, the attendants prayed for Muslims and reiterated their hopes for an Islamic Union.
On the second day, the delegation paid a high profile visit to the Governor of Istanbul , accompanied by representatives of A9 TV.

The highlight of the visit was the statements of hope from both sides for the immediate establishment of an Islamic Union. The Egyptian side sought advice on how they could speed up the process of reforming their country, including ways to fight corruption, cleaning up the streets, and improving human rights. Dr. Dardery said that Turkey is a much beloved country for Egyptians and they long to see a stronger alliance both between the two countries and the rest of the Islamic world for permanent peace on earth for everyone.
The governor said that he couldn’t agree more and shared his insight on the Turkish experience and added that as a part of his faith, he doesn’t see himself as a man serving only the Turkish people, but all Muslims throughout the world.
The party then headed to a meeting with the Istanbul Deputy Mayor where they exchanged ideas on how to improve city services. The mayor’s office gave detailed insights as to recent works in Istanbul, and how they managed to change the face of Istanbul completely.
The visit culminated in a live appearance on Adnan Oktar’s popular TV channel A9 together with Adnan Oktar himself. Oktar opened the program saying that they were honored to have their guests and one of the members in the delegation of Dr. Dardery returned the compliment saying that they have known Adnan Oktar (HarunYahya) since they were kids and grew up reading his books and watching his documentaries on plasma screens at the university. Dr. Dardery said that Egyptians have and always will love Turkey and the Turkish people and look up to Turkey as a great model to further their country.

When Oktar asked him about an Islamic Union model which will bring Unity to to the region, Dardery heartily agreed in principle. Oktar said that only such a union would be able to put an end to the confusion and conflicts going on at the moment, as it would harness the power of Muslims under one compassionate, loving and democratic leader who has love for everyone regardless of faith or ethnicities and that only such a union would put an end to radicalism, as this union would be based on a moderate understanding of Islam that is purely peaceful and filled with love, which is the true nature of Islam according to the Qur’an.
Dardery said that Egyptians would love to be a part of that union, and that he cannot wait to see that happen and would do whatever it took on their part to contribute to that.
The Egyptian delegation departed after exchanging traditional gifts and photo sessions.
